Don’t warn about integer conversion in pdumper.c
Problem reported by Juanma Barranquero in: https://lists.gnu.org/r/emacs-devel/2020-08/msg00279.html and a similar glitch was reported by Eli Zaretskii (Bug#36597#67). * src/pdumper.c: Remove -Wconversion pragma. (ALLOW_IMPLICIT_CONVERSION, DISALLOW_IMPLICIT_CONVERSION): Remove. All uses removed. Although -Wconversion may have been helpful when writing pdumper.c it is now causing more trouble than it’s worth here (just as in the rest of Emacs). (dump_read_all): Avoid no-longer-necessary use of ‘size_t’ rather than ‘int’.
